What Exactly Is Liquidmetal?
什么是液态金属?
Liquidmetal (often called metallic glass or amorphous metal) is a revolutionary alloy that cools so rapidly during manufacturing that its atoms don’t form the usual rigid crystal lattice. Instead, they remain in a disordered, glass like structure. The result? A material that’s:
• Extremely strong and hard (rumors suggest 2 to 2.5 times stronger than titanium in comparable alloys)
• Highly resistant to permanent deformation and fatigue
• Excellent at spring like elastic recovery
• Capable of being precision die cast into complex shapes
液态金属(常被称为金属玻璃或非晶态金属)是一种革命性合金,在制造过程中冷却速度极快,原子无法形成常规的刚性晶体晶格,而是保持无序、类玻璃的结构。由此带来的特性包括:
• 极高的强度与硬度(消息称强度达到同等钛合金的2至2.5倍)
• 极强的抗永久变形与抗疲劳性能
• 优秀的类弹簧弹性恢复能力
• 可通过精密压铸制成复杂结构
Apple has held exclusive rights to use Liquidmetal Technologies’ IP in consumer electronics since 2010. Until now, its appearances have been limited to tiny parts like SIM ejector pins. The foldable iPhone hinge would mark the material’s first major mechanical role in an Apple product.
苹果自2010年起就拥有液态金属技术公司相关知识产权在消费电子领域的独家使用权。在此之前,该材料仅被用于SIM卡取卡针等微小零部件。折叠屏iPhone铰链将是该材料首次在苹果产品中承担核心力学结构角色。
Why a Foldable Hinge Demands Something This Advanced
为何折叠屏铰链需要如此先进的材料?
Traditional foldable phone hinges rely on intricate multi link mechanisms made from stainless steel, aluminum, or titanium. Over hundreds of thousands of folds, these parts can wear, develop play, or fail to keep the screen perfectly flat, leading to the dreaded visible crease that plagues most current foldables.
传统折叠屏手机铰链依赖由不锈钢、铝或钛合金制成的复杂多连杆结构。在数十万次弯折后,这些部件会出现磨损、松动,无法维持屏幕完全平整,进而产生绝大多数现有折叠屏机型都存在的显眼折痕。
Aaron Lee for DigiTimes Asia:
DigiTimes Asia 记者 Aaron Lee:
Apple’s first foldable device has entered its final countdown phase. Reports from the supply chain indicate that the new device features significant breakthroughs in both its external structure and key materials. Notably, the hinge mechanism incorporates Liquidmetal—an amorphous alloy—marking the industry’s first instance of large-scale commercial application for this material. It is understood that Liquidmetal possesses characteristics such as high strength, superior wear resistance, and excellent fluidity. These properties enable the fabrication of hinge structures with greater complexity and precision, while simultaneously allowing for effective control over device thickness; thus, it serves as the core technology underpinning the lightweight and durable design of the foldable iPhone. On the materials front, Eontec acts as the exclusive supplier of zirconium-based Liquidmetal, while Taiwanese manufacturers Newmax and Amphenol share the responsibility for module assembly. The entire supply chain has now entered the trial production and validation phase. Although the timeline for mass production has been slightly delayed due to yield-related factors, Apple remains firmly committed to the Liquidmetal approach and has not activated any alternative plans. Mass production is expected to officially commence in the third quarter of 2026, with shipments projected to reach their peak in the fourth quarter.
苹果首款折叠屏设备已进入最终倒计时阶段。供应链消息显示,新品在外部结构与核心材料上均实现重大突破。值得注意的是,铰链机构采用液态金属(一种非晶合金),这是该材料在行业内首次大规模商用。据悉,液态金属具备高强度、高耐磨性、优异流动性等特点,可制造更复杂、更高精度的铰链结构,同时有效控制机身厚度,是支撑折叠屏iPhone实现轻薄与耐用设计的核心技术。材料方面,宜安科技为锆基液态金属独家供应商,台湾厂商新日兴与安费诺共同负责模组组装。整个供应链已进入试产验证阶段。尽管因良率因素量产时间略有延后,但苹果坚定坚持液态金属方案,并未启动任何替代计划。预计2026年第三季度正式量产,第四季度出货达到高峰。
Currently, Eontec has achieved a material yield rate exceeding 90%; the bottlenecks are now concentrated in the module assembly stage. It is projected that the conditions required for mass production will be met by the end of July. Regarding shipment volume, market analysts anticipate that the foldable iPhone will see shipments of approximately 6 to 7 million units in its first year. Due to limited supplies of key components, the device is expected to face shortages during its initial launch period.
目前宜安科技材料良率已突破90%,瓶颈集中在模组组装环节,预计7月底具备大规模量产条件。出货量方面,市场分析师预计折叠屏iPhone首年出货约600–700万台。由于核心零部件供应受限,上市初期将面临缺货。
Analyst Ming Chi Kuo and multiple supply chain sources claim Apple is turning to Liquidmetal precisely to solve these issues:
• Superior durability under repeated flexing
• Better screen flatness when unfolded, minimizing or eliminating crease impressions
• Tighter tolerances thanks to die casting, allowing a slimmer overall design (rumored 4.5 to 5.5 mm unfolded)
• Spring like behavior that helps the device snap open and close smoothly while maintaining long term reliability
分析师郭明錤及多家供应链消息指出,苹果选用液态金属正是为了解决以下问题:
• 反复弯折下的超高耐用性
• 展开后更好的屏幕平整度,减少甚至消除折痕
• 压铸工艺带来更高精度,实现更纤薄的整体设计(传闻展开厚度4.5–5.5毫米)
• 类弹性特性使开合更顺畅,并保持长期可靠性
Paired with an upgraded titanium alloy chassis (lighter yet stronger than current iPhone titanium frames), the combination could deliver a premium feel without excessive weight.
搭配升级款钛合金机身(比现有iPhone钛金属边框更轻更强),整体可在不过度增重的前提下提供高端质感。
The Long Road to This Moment
漫长的落地之路
Apple has been eyeing Liquidmetal for hinges and moving parts in patents for years. The material’s unique properties make it theoretically ideal for anything that needs to bend repeatedly without breaking or loosening. Scaling production for high volume, precision components has always been the hurdle, but recent reports suggest suppliers like Dongguan EonTec are already shipping significant volumes of Liquidmetal based hinge elements, positioning them for Apple’s potential orders.
苹果多年来一直在专利中规划将液态金属用于铰链与活动部件。该材料的独特特性使其理论上非常适合需要反复弯折而不断裂、不松动的结构。高精密零部件的规模化量产一直是最大障碍,但最新消息显示,东莞宜安等供应商已开始大批量出货液态金属铰链部件,为苹果订单做好准备。
If mass production ramps in late 2026, the first foldable iPhone (expected as a 7.8 inch inner / 5.5 inch outer book style device) could ship with this advanced hinge in 2026 or early 2027.
若2026年底量产顺利,首款折叠屏iPhone(预计为7.8英寸内屏+5.5英寸外屏的横向内折方案)有望在2026年或2027年初上市。
Will It Finally Kill the Crease?
它能彻底消除折痕吗?
Rumors suggest Apple is combining the Liquidmetal hinge with specialized display tech (possibly dual layer or chemically treated glass from Samsung) aimed at near crease free performance. While no foldable has completely eliminated the crease yet, Apple’s obsessive focus on materials and tight integration could get closer than anyone else.
消息称,苹果将液态金属铰链与专用显示技术(可能是三星提供的双层结构或特殊化学处理玻璃)结合,目标实现接近无折痕效果。尽管目前没有任何折叠屏能完全消除折痕,但苹果在材料与系统整合上的极致追求有望做到行业最优。
Of course, these are still rumors. Apple could iterate further, or challenges in high volume manufacturing could push timelines. But the consistent drumbeat from analysts like Kuo and supply chain leakers indicates serious momentum.
当然,目前仍属传闻。苹果可能继续迭代方案,或因大规模量产难题推迟时间节点。但郭明錤等分析师与供应链消息持续释放信号,项目推进势头明确。
